Logging In to the VPN Firewall
To connect to the VPN firewall, your computer needs to be configured to obtain an IP address
automatically from the VPN firewall via DHCP. For instructions on how to configure your
computer for DHCP, see the “Preparing Your Network” document, which you can access from
Appendix E, “Related Documents.”
To connect and log in to the VPN firewall:
1. Start any of the qualified Web browsers, as explained in “Qualified Web Browsers” on
page 2-2.
2. Enter https://192.168.1.1 in the address field. The NETGEAR Configuration Manager Login
screen displays in the browser.
Note: The VPN firewall factory default IP address is 192.168.1.1. If you change the
IP address, you must use the IP address that you assigned to the VPN firewall
to log in to the VPN firewall.
